Short freezes when accessing HDD

I'm having trouble with my ASUS UX31E laptop. I first came across this problem late September/early October. I fled to elementary OS since they use older packages, thinking it was just some weird package bug, but when the problem arrived there too I finally switched back to Arch yesterday.

Whenever a program tries to read/write to my hard drive (SanDisk SSD U100 128GB) it takes forever (ranging from a single second to half a minute) causing a freeze of the program. Meanwhile every other program that tries to access the hard drive freezes too. When the hard drive has 'catched up' again eveything works as intended until the next time I try to access my hard drive. It's extremely annoying since this can occur several times per minute.

I even noticed this when installing Arch from my USB stick using nothing more than a CLI. When I installed the base package group, several packages installed themselves quickly in a 'spurt', then the laptop waited 30 - 60 seconds before continuing. In between the 'spurts' the cursor just flashed on a blank line. The same problem also occured when tab autocompleting a command. I'd hit tab, the computer would freeze for roughly 30 seconds, and then the command would be successfully autocompleted. The latter implies the problem is more than a failed hard drive.

The only common factor I can think of is the kernel.

I can't find anything in the logs of interest, but I'll post whichever if you need me to. I'm completely stumped. What should I do to locate and fix the problem?
